A store is having a 20%-off sale. It gives an additional 10% off if the item is still above $100

after the first discount. A jacket costs $149.99. Will you get the second discount and if so, how
many dollars will you save in total?

The answers are:
Yes; 42.00
Yes; 14.49
No
Yes; 30.00

To determine if you will receive the second discount, we need to calculate the price of the jacket after the first discount.

20% off $149.99 can be calculated by multiplying the price by 0.20:

20% * $149.99 = $29.998
Rounded to the nearest cent, the discount is $30.00.

To calculate the new price after applying the first discount:

$149.99 - $30.00 = $119.99

Since the new price ($119.99) is above $100, you are eligible for the second discount.

To calculate the second discount of 10%:

10% of $119.99 can be calculated by multiplying the price by 0.10:

10% * $119.99 = $11.999
Rounded to the nearest cent, the discount is $12.00.

To calculate the total savings:

$30.00 + $12.00 = $42.00

Therefore, you will receive the second discount and save a total of $42.00.

The answer is: Yes; $42.00
